Transaction 22a85c8c8998a3ceb0fc7277b415d6f89d4b6182008153d004468b21c5c9f618
1 Input
1 Output
-
22a85c8c8998a3ceb0fc7277b415d6f89d4b6182008153d004468b21c5c9f618:0
- value
- 20436
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 18189d98a5beb0bf66f48f5e5021f31f2ff1d2a97812c42da36bd33b90181780
- address
- bc1prqvfmx99h6ct7eh53a09qg0nruhlr54f0qfvgtdrd0fnhyqcz7qq2frlu9